Operator-Friendly Feeder and Stacker
One of the significant updates is the stationary feeder. Operators no longer need to pull the feeder in and out, a laborious task that often required extra effort or assistance. Instead, the Gen2 features a sliding bridge, allowing full access to the coating head without the hassle of repositioning the feeder.
This change also reduces the required footprint of the machine. While the physical length of the ZR30 Gen2 remains the same as its predecessor at 21 feet, operators no longer need to move the feeder in and out, which saves required working space and simplifies pressroom layout. It also enhances operator access for maintenance and setup, making day-to-day operation more efficient.
Additionally, the Gen2 introduces side loading capabilities, which allow operators to load sheets from either the side or the end. This improves workflow and makes the unit easier to fit into tight spaces.

External Pumping System
Coating changeovers and maintenance just got simpler. The Gen2 features an external circulation system. The LithoCoat system uses the same industrial circulator found on offset presses such as Koenig & Bauer, Komori, and RMGT, as well as on digital platforms like Landa, HP PageWide Web Presses, and Kodak Prospers. This system allows for faster changeovers, easier access to pumps for serviceability, better fluid handling, and compatibility with various coating container sizes, providing customers greater flexibility in coating supply management.

Separate UV and IR Modules
Our customers requested more modularity, and the ZR30 Gen2 delivers. For printers focused solely on AQ coatings or water-based primers, the system can now be ordered without UV curing capability. Removing the UV module reduces both cost and overall machine footprint, offering additional space savings for pressrooms with limited floor area. For those who need UV, the system has been upgraded to an electronic ballast with a shutter system that improves power-up time, efficiency, and operator safety. This flexibility allows the machine to be tailored precisely to production needs.
Optimized Paper Path Height
The paper path height has been lowered to 100 cm, aligning with industry standards for a more seamless integration into existing production environments.
